The Story of Audell
This melodic name combines classic strength with a gentle grace, a fitting destiny for your daughter.
Audell likely arises from a fusion of 'Audrey,' meaning 'noble strength,' and the suffix '-ell,' lending it a sweet, lyrical quality. First documented in 1919, it emerged during a time of evolving feminine names, offering a delicate yet resilient sound.
